Japanese Aircraft Carriers, 1920-1945

By Ermanno Martino

Japanese Aircraft Carriers presents a comprehensive technical history of all 29 Imperial Japanese Navy (IJN) aircraft carriers. This definitive English-language reference details the evolution of IJN naval air power, from the pioneering *Hosho*—the world's first purpose-designed carrier—to diverse wartime conversions and austere builds. Each vessel's design, operational context, and unique characteristics are explored through insightful text and over 200 illustrations, including photos, plans, and color camouflage schemes. A vital resource for naval historians and enthusiasts, this book fills a significant gap in scholarship.
